Jasprit Bumrah’s Abrupt Exit: Implications for Indian Cricket and Athlete Welfare

The sudden departure of Jasprit Bumrah from the field during the second day’s post-lunch session of a pivotal Test match has generated widespread discourse within the cricketing sphere. "Bumrah had left the field for scans during the second day's post-lunch session after bowling just one over as he felt some discomfort." This unforeseen incident raises critical questions about his fitness and its subsequent impact on India’s strategic outlook. The event has underscored the fragility of physical resilience in professional cricket and the broader implications for team dynamics.
